This typeface is a slanted sans with smooth, rounded construction and a consistent, even stroke. Curves are generous and open, with softly terminated ends that feel more drawn than engineered. Proportions are balanced and readable, with round counters and a gentle rhythm in mixed text; the numerals follow the same rounded, slightly calligraphic logic for a cohesive texture.
It works well for UI and product text where a friendly tone is desired, as well as editorial pull quotes and subheads that benefit from a relaxed slant. The clean, rounded shapes also suit contemporary branding, packaging copy, and light signage where approachability and legibility need to coexist.
The overall tone is warm and informal while staying tidy and contemporary. Its soft curves and steady slant give it a conversational, easygoing voice that feels more personable than strictly technical.
The design appears intended to deliver an approachable, humanist alternative to stricter sans italics—retaining clean readability while adding warmth through rounded forms and a gentle, continuous slant.
In text, spacing appears comfortable and the letterforms maintain clarity at paragraph scale, producing an even gray value without harsh corners. The slant is noticeable but controlled, supporting emphasis without becoming cursive.
